Supernaughty are four old-school rockers raised in the coastal city of Livorno.
Formed in the 2014, play a massive heavy rock highly influenced by early grunge and stoner sonorities. Thanks to the band for donating codes for this week’s Friday Freebie. Check em out and support on their bandcamp page.
